College World Series 2025 Softball Location

College World Series 2025 Softball Location. How to watch women's college world series 2025. Who is broadcasting the 2025 womens' college world series?


College World Series 2025 Softball Location

The women’s college world series is held annually at devon park in oklahoma city. Here’s what to know for the wcws, including times, dates, tv schedule and streaming info:

College World Series 2025 Softball Location Images References :